Post by: Donkey Kong Genius on March 15, 2014, 11:06:06 pm
No problem, congrats on the 200K! Yup, that is normal. The levels are 1 thru 9, then there are 7 blank levels, and then A - F, F-1 being the killscreen.

Post by: marky_d on March 16, 2014, 06:24:18 am
The levels are 1 thru 9, then there are 7 blank levels, and then A - F, F-1 being the killscreen.

It's also interesting to note that Junior (as does Popeye) cycles through the character tilemap for use as the level indicator. So if Junior didn't have the timer bug, it would have used what is seen here:

Post by: marky_d on March 20, 2014, 11:07:09 am
If you aren't concerned with points at all, it's a good idea to try and push the far left key up first, as it seems the snapjaws tend to congregate around that area toward the end of the screen and that can make it tricky to finish if that key is left for last. If you manage to get that key out of the way, smashing snapjaws with the right apple will make the screen that much easier to finish because they will respawn on the left side of the board. Learn where the safe spots between the birds are, and use them to wait and see what the snapjaws decide to do before making your move to push up keys. I think it is easier to wait in these spots with both hands on one chain because it "seems" that your vertical hitbox is slightly smaller. If you wait spread-eagle, it's easy to misjudge your position and accidentally get hit on his raised hand. The other thing you may notice is that when the snapjaws are at the top of the structure waiting to decide which chain to take down they will move at a slow or fast mode (sometimes they freeze). If you notice one go into fast mode, be careful, because they are probably going to make their decision faster to go down a chain. Hope this helps. Oh, and yeah save-states help, but be sure to play full games often to put everything you learn together.

I'm not an OBS expert, but "fit to screen" won't have any noticeable effect if your MAME window already fills one dimension of the screen (in this case, vertical).  Increasing the size horizontally would involve changing the aspect ratio, and I don't think you want to do that.  For the record, it looks pretty good as is.

Step 2:  Go to "Settings... => Broadcast Settings" and make sure the "Save to file:" box is checked.  Specify an output file in the "File path:" field below (or use the "Browse..." button).  You can also optionally check the "Keep recording if live stream stops:" box.

Step 3:  I don't own a webcam, so I'll defer to someone who does.

You definitely want to get away from Justin TV.  They've recently removed the highlight feature (temporarily, or so they say), and they no longer support inbox messaging.  If you've selected the "Automatically archive my broadcasts" option in "General Video Settings:", your videos will only be saved for 2 days (unless you purchase a premium plan).  No thanks.

Yup its probably the monitor.  I recommend checking the fuses across the chassis.  I fixed my monitor by replacing a simple fuse in my monitor.  Your problem is most definitely the monitor based on your problems. http://i172.photobucket.com/albums/w7/modessitt/SanyoBoardControls.jpg (http://i172.photobucket.com/albums/w7/modessitt/SanyoBoardControls.jpg)
Check f301 and f302 for failure.  In my case, f301 was dead, causing the whole game to appear to be lifeless.  Check the fuses using the continuity setting on your multimeter, and take them out of the PCB.  That way, the circuit isn't bleeding out any bad signals to your meter.  Good luck my friend.  If those fuses are good, your flyback and/or HOT are likely to be dead.

ah okay.  When you say RGB board, you mean this: http://img6.imageshack.us/img6/7410/1001820.png (http://img6.imageshack.us/img6/7410/1001820.png) board right?  That is actually called the inverter board, and that is the name it is generally called.  If that is the board you removed, you dont actually need it.  In older nintendo games, the signal is already inverted, so a board that does the inverting isnt even necessary.  To bypass this board completely, follow the attached diagram.  This makes it so the chassis is getting direct video from the game board since the inverter board isn't necessary in this case.  Of course, your chassis still has problems even after fixing this.  The solution to this problem is to either fix it yourself, or buy a whole new chassis.  I would try replacing the fuses that I mentioned a couple of weeks ago, if you haven't already done so.  After doing that, if it still doesn't work, you are probably SOL.  It's just way too much work to do on your own, if you aren't an electrical engineer.  At that point, I would either send it to somebody on KLOV to be repaired, or just buy a whole new chassis.  That is all of the outcomes I can think of to get your game working again.  Good luck and keep me posted.

Yeah my DK JR has the slight jumping sound.  It's mainly do to the old audio board in the monitor needing to be capped.  It's not really a big deal, but I'm personally capping my audio board when I cap my monitor. In terms of your color problems,  I would try adjusting the brightness and focus adjustments to try to brighten up your colors a bit. These adjustments are located on the flyback which is under the flyback cage.  When removing the flyback cage, be sure the power is turned off.  You can make adjustments to it while the monitor is turned on with a long flat head screwdriver.  If the adjustments still aren't good, it's just old caps, and they need replacing.

There are actually 3 brightness settings in total.  One on the actual board, one on the adjustment board, and of on the flyback.  The one on the flyback allows for the most dramatic adjustments.  There is only one focus adjustment, which is on the flyback.
